@@ -0,0 +1,263 @@+-- | A simple string substitution library that supports \"$\"-based+-- substitution. Substitution uses the following rules:+--+-- * \"$$\" is an escape; it is replaced with a single \"$\".+--+-- * \"$identifier\" names a substitution placeholder matching a+-- mapping key of \"identifier\". \"identifier\" must spell a+-- Haskell identifier. The first non-identifier character after the+-- \"$\" character terminates this placeholder specification.+--+-- * \"${identifier}\" is equivalent to \"$identifier\". It is+-- required when valid identifier characters follow the placeholder+-- but are not part of the placeholder, such as+-- \"${noun}ification\".+--+-- Any other apperance of \"$\" in the string will result in an+-- 'Prelude.error' being raised.+--+-- Here is an example of a simple substitution:+--+-- > import qualified Data.ByteString.Lazy.Char8 as B+-- > import Text.Template+-- >+-- > context = Map.fromList . map packPair+-- > where packPair (x, y) = (B.pack x, B.pack y)+-- >+-- > helloTemplate = B.pack "Hello, $name! Want some ${fruit}s?"+-- > helloContext = context [("name", "Johan"), ("fruit", "banana")]+-- >+-- > main = B.putStrLn $ substitute helloTemplate helloContext+--+-- If you render the same template multiple times it's faster to first+-- convert it to a more efficient representation using 'template' and+-- then rendering it using 'render'.
